Acute Nurse
4 months ago
Are you a compassionate and skilled nurse looking for a dynamic role in acute care?Here is a good news for you.We at Randstad are looking for enthusiastic and professional Acute Nurses to join our leading health care agency. Work Flexibility: Say goodbye to the 9-to-5 shifts. With us, you have the freedom to create a schedule that suits your lifestyle. Whether you prefer day shifts, night shifts, we'll work with you to find the perfect fit. Competitive and Clear Pay Rates: Monday to Friday day shift : £31.10 per hour Saturday day shift : £40.43 per hour Sunday day shift : £49.75 per hour Monday to Friday night shift : £40.43 per hour Saturday night shift : £40.43 per hour Sunday night shift : £49.75 per hour Bank Holiday : £49.75 per hour Responsbilities:
- Perform comprehensive assessments of patients' health status upon admission and throughout their stay.
- Monitor patients' vital signs, symptoms, and response to treatment, identifying any changes or deterioration in their condition.
- Administer medications, intravenous fluids, and treatments as prescribed by physicians.
- Maintaining accurate and detailed records of patients' assessments, interventions, and responses to treatment.
- Adhering to strict infection control protocols to prevent the spread of infections within healthcare settings.
- NMC registration and PIN
- A minimum of 12 months post qualified work experience
- Strong clinical skills and meticulous attention to detail
- Exceptional communication and interpersonal abilities
- Effective teamwork and the ability to work independently
